Double D:

We are making 20 year lows, that is pretty significant. Finding support at levels reached 20 years is difficult at best.

John Bollinger was on CNBC and using long term charts, he believes gold is leading the long bond lower. He is of the school that we are still in a deflationary environment.

This board is of the mindset, that y2k will provide a significant amount of dislocation to the world economy. If that thesis proves correct, Bollinger may be right in his disinflationary theme. y2k choas in the developing nations may reignite the currency problems of last year with all of its economic impact.
